ACCUCOMS Prepares for Restart as Founder and Managing Director, Pinar
Erzin Buys Back the Company

6 November 2014 | Leiden, The Netherlands - Accucoms, the leading
provider of sales and marketing services for publishers with
headquarters in Leiden, The Netherlands, has been bought back by
founder and managing director Pinar Erzin, together with key
management: Egon Menardi, Simon Boisseau and Rakesh Malik.

This news follows the recent announcement that Swets Information
Services B.V., the parent company of Accucoms B.V. was declared
bankrupt on the 23rd September this year, with Accucoms B.V. equally
declared bankrupt on the 1st October.

Stakeholders have been working hard to restart the company since the
announcement of the bankruptcy of Accucoms B.V. As of today, the 6th
of November of 2014, Pinar Erzin has signed an agreement with the
trustee in bankruptcy of Accucoms B.V. regarding the assets of
Accucoms B.V. to restart the company. Current staff of Accucoms will
be re-employed and will continue to operate from the Leiden
headquarters until the 28th of November 2014. Furthermore, publishers
who are customers of Accucoms B.V. will be contacted shortly by the
new company about the way forward and the continuation of projects.

About ACCUCOMS

ACCUCOMS is an independent provider of services to academic and
professional publishers around the world. Established in 2004,
ACCUCOMS operates in Europe, Turkey, North America, Latin America,
India and MENA. ACCUCOMS’ multilingual teams offer efficient and
intelligent representation, telemarketing and business intelligence
services as well as user interaction programs to clients that range
from large publishing houses to specialist society publishers.  For
